The Teams: A Tale of Two Cities

First off, let's get acquainted with our contenders. Kagawa (referred to as Kamatamare Sanuki) represents the vibrant prefecture of Kagawa, known for its delicious Sanuki udon noodles and a strong community spirit. Their football club embodies this spirit, aiming to bring joy and pride to their local fans. They are known for their resilience and never-say-die attitude. Their home ground, Pikara Stadium, is often buzzing with enthusiastic supporters eager to witness their team's performance. The team's history has seen its fair share of ups and downs, but their unwavering commitment to developing young talent and playing attractive football has always remained consistent. They have been working hard to improve their standing in the J3 League, and every match is a chance to climb higher.
